Roof weatherproofing services involve applying protective materials or coatings to a roof’s surface to create a barrier against the elements. This process helps prevent water infiltration, reducing the risk of leaks and water damage inside the home. Weatherproofing can include sealing cracks, adding waterproof membranes, or applying specialized coatings that enhance the roof’s resistance to rain, snow, and extreme weather conditions. These services are designed to extend the lifespan of a roof by shielding it from the wear and tear caused by moisture and harsh weather.

Many common roofing problems can be addressed or prevented through weatherproofing. For example, aging shingles or tiles may develop cracks or gaps that allow water to seep in. Flat roofs or low-slope surfaces are especially vulnerable to pooling water, which can lead to leaks if not properly sealed. Additionally, homes with poor drainage or existing damage may benefit from weatherproofing to reinforce the roof’s defenses. By addressing these issues early, homeowners can avoid costly repairs and maintain a more secure, dry interior environment.

Weatherproofing services are often used on a variety of property types, including single-family homes, multi-family residences, and commercial buildings. Residential properties with older roofs or those located in areas prone to heavy rain and snow are common candidates. Commercial properties with flat or low-slope roofs frequently require weatherproofing to prevent leaks that could disrupt business operations. Overall, any property that faces exposure to moisture and weather extremes can benefit from professional weatherproofing to improve durability and protect the investment in the roof.

The overview below groups typical Roof Weatherpro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Middleton, ID.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or weatherproofing repairs on roofs in Middleton range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as sealing small leaks or replacing damaged shingles, fall within this range. Fewer projects tend to push beyond this band unless additional work is required.

Moderate Projects - Mid-sized weatherproofing projects, including partial roof coatings or patching larger sections, usually cost between $600 and $1,500. These jobs are common for homeowners seeking to extend roof life without full replacement.

Full Roof Coatings - Applying a comprehensive weatherproof coating across an entire roof typically costs between $2,000 and $4,500. Larger, more complex roofs in Middleton may reach the high end of this range, but many projects stay within the middle tiers.

Complete Roof Replacement - For roofs requiring full replacement due to extensive weather damage, costs generally start around $5,000 and can exceed $10,000. These are less frequent but represent the upper tier of weatherproofing expenses for larger or more intricate roof systems.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
